Noboru Takachi was born on December 22, 1964 in Kochi, Kochi, Japan. He is an actor, known for The Negotiator: The Movie (2010), A Fresh Breeze (2004) and Anata no tonari ni dare ka iru (2003). He was previously married to Reiko Takashima and Momo Aida.